Simple Ways

Simple Ways

A Poem by Jeff Bresee

I woke one day as I recall,

years back in time but not in mind.

The reason I know not at all,

but felt I there and humbled knew,

for peace distilled as morning dew -

life is a gift indeed.

 

Then from that morn 

the years have passed,

whilst way to way filled up the day

and brought me where I stand at last -

worn thin of wear and weak of will.

Yet in my mind the memory still

stirs deep inside my soul.

 

That life is yet a gift indeed,

with open wings 

and wondrous things.

Free to the soul who takes not speed,

but rather stands with thankful heart

and from the simple won’t depart

but holds to what is free.

 

So, now I pause when I awake

with mind that I shall pray and try

to never want nor granted take,

but rather live in simple ways

and cherish what each blessed day…

I’m given holds in store.

© 2024 Jeff Bresee
